METHOD FOR DETERMINING LOCAL PORTIONS OF MAIN PIPELINES WITH MAXIMAL DEFORMATION Russian patent published in 2006 - IPC G01B17/02 

Abstract RU 2272248 C1

FIELD: technology for determining local portions of main pipelines with maximal deformation.

SUBSTANCE: method includes measuring oscillations of pipe in area of chambers of launch and receipt, oscillations of body at its immobile state, frequencies and coefficients of damping of fading oscillations are determined for body acceleration as well as transition process time during passage of junctions for selection of spectral analysis distance, spectral characteristics of acceleration signals are estimated for vertical direction of body between junctions, amplitudes level is excluded which is equal to noise in form of pipe and body oscillations at its immobile state, and also pulsing of as pressure; at discontinuous frequencies maximal resonance values are detected for components of Fourier decomposition of acceleration signals, frequencies of three forms of pipe oscillations are detected at representative portions, their positions are determined at route of main pipeline as well as their oscillation amplitudes.

EFFECT: possible estimation of vertical and horizontal deformations of pipelines.
